About Austin Bridge & Road
A leader in the heavy highway and transportation industry for more than 100 years, Austin Bridge & Road delivers asphalt and concrete services, and builds landmark projects such as complex highway interchanges, tollways, runways, bridges, rail projects, and water/wastewater facilities.
About the Role
This Engineer II position joins the Heavy Civil project team in the Greenville, Texas/Hunt County area. This role, on the Project Manager career track, supports key engineering functions, including procurement and expediting of construction materials, while driving excellence in heavy civil construction.
Responsibilities
- Procure materials and ensure timely delivery
- Prepare detailed cost estimates for proposed changes
- Update contract plans and master schedules
- Oversee and manage submittals
- Track materials, coordinate projects, and enforce safety standards
- Analyze, review, and update job cost information
- Process change orders per project owner requirements
- Manage subcontractors effectively
- Respond to RFIs from owners and subcontractors
- Compile and deliver close-out documents, including drawings, warranties, and service manuals
- Perform additional duties as assigned
